The Embryo (Al-Alaq)
In the name of Allah, the Beneficent, the Merciful
Read! In the Name of your Lord, Who has created (all that exists), 1 created the human from a (blood) clot. 2 Read, and your Lord only is the Most Beneficent, 3 who taught by the Pen, 4 taught the human what he did not know. 5 Despite this, the human being still tends to rebel 6 because he thinks that he is independent. 7 Verily, to thy Lord is the return (of all). 8 Have you (O Muhammad (Peace be upon him)) seen him (i.e. Abu Jahl) who prevents, 9 A servant when he prays? 10 What will happen if the praying person is rightly guided 11 Or enjoins righteousness? 12 Have you considered if he gives the lie to the truth and turns (his) back? 13 Does he not know that Allah sees everything? 14 Let him know that if he does not desist, We shall certainly drag him by his forelocks, 15 his lying sinful forelock. 16 So let him call on his concourse! 17 We shall summon the guards of Hell. 18 Nay! obey him not, and make obeisance and draw nigh (to Allah). ۩ 19
Almighty Allah's Truth.
